1. What is a roller conveyor?
A roller conveyor uses a series of parallel rotating rollers mounted in a frame to move cartons, totes, trays or pallets. Variants split along two axes: drive (gravity, belt-driven, chain-driven, 24 V MDR) and load class (light carton, medium tote, heavy pallet).
2. The five variants you actually choose between
| Variant | Typical load | Throughput | Indicative cost (€/m) | Best for |
|---|---|---|---|---|
| Gravity roller | 1–35 kg cartons | Manual | 120–250 | Docks, returns, short manual lines |
| Belt-driven roller | 5–50 kg | Up to ~3 000 cph | 450–700 | Long straight runs, heavy cartons |
| Chain-driven roller | 50–1 500 kg pallets | Up to 600 pallets/h | 800–1 400 | Pallet transport, AS/RS infeed |
| 24V MDR (motorized) | 1–50 kg totes/cartons | 2 000–4 500 cph | 500–900 | Automated DCs, e-commerce |
| Lineshaft | 10–35 kg | Up to ~2 000 cph | 350–550 | Legacy refurb, low capex |
For new European projects in 2026, 24V MDR is the default for case and tote handling; chain-driven remains the default for pallets.
3. Sizing rules you can apply on a napkin
- Three rollers under the smallest load at all times — set roller pitch from the smallest carton, not the average.
- Frame width = load width + 50–100 mm clearance.
- Roller diameter: 40 mm for ≤15 kg, 50 mm for 15–35 kg, 60 mm and up for heavier loads.
- Accumulation length ≥ 1.5× the longest expected upstream stoppage at design throughput.
- Inclines: gravity ≤ 4°, powered roller ≤ 5–7° with high-friction rings; above that switch to belt.
4. Integration with WMS and WCS
A modern roller conveyor is a software product as much as a mechanical one. The WCS (Warehouse Control System) drives zone logic, accumulation and merge priority in real time; the WMS issues higher-order tasks (allocate, release, pick wave). Critical integration patterns:
- Zone-level telegrams to/from the WCS (load arrived, zone clear, error code).
- Photo-eye + scanner pairs at decision points feed sortation logic.
- OPC-UA or MQTT for plant-level dashboards and predictive maintenance.
5. Energy, noise and OPEX
24 V MDR with zero-pressure accumulation consumes 30–50% less energy than always-on 400 V belt-driven lines, because motors stop when no load is present. Noise drops from ~75 dB(A) to ~62 dB(A) — material in pharma and food environments where SLA noise limits apply.
6. When NOT to use a roller conveyor
- Small, light or fragile items (jewellery, electronics blisters) — use belt or modular plastic.
- Wet or sticky environments — modular plastic belts wash down better.
- Variable-shape items that won't track straight — use belt or AMRs.
- Inclines > 7° — use belt with cleats or spiral conveyors.
